Chihuahua
This breed has an average life span of anywhere between 13 and 18 years. In some rare cases Chihuahuas have been known to live up to 25 years.
Dachshund
Dachshunds have an average life span of 12 – 16 years. However, they have been recorded as living for 20 years and over!

– Are there any tips on how to keep my Dachshund healthy for longer?
It is important to feed your Dachshund a high quality diet with the correct nutrients to make sure they are happy and healthy. You should also exercise them often, brush their teeth regularly, provide them with safe chew toys and spend time playing with them. It’s also good to make sure that you don’t allow your pup to overheat in hot weather or become exposed to dangerous substances that could harm it.
